Shia LaBeouf’s Mutt Williams won’t appear in Indiana Jones 5

September 6, 2017 by Gary Collinson

Some bad news for the one or two people out there looking forward to seeing the return of Mutt Williams in the upcoming fifth instalment of the Indiana Jones franchise, as screenwriter David Koepp has revealed that Shia LaBeouf’s Indy Jr. will not be appearing in the film.

“Harrison plays Indiana Jones, that I can certainly say…  and the Shia LaBeouf character is not in the film,” said Koepp, before providing an update on their progress with the sequel: “We’re plugging away at it. In terms of when we would start, I think that’s up to Mr. Spielberg and Mr. Ford… I know we’ve got a script we’re mostly happy with. Work will be endless, of course, and ongoing, and Steven just finished shooting The Post… If the stars align, hopefully it’ll be his next film.”

EW also pressed Koepp for some information about the film’s MacGuffin, but the screenwriter wasn’t given anything away, responding that: “[It’s] some precious artifact that they’re all looking for.”

Indiana Jones 5 is currently slated for release on July 10th, 2020.
